Description

Drench your hands in our iconic Objets d'Amsterdam fragrance with this cleansing and hydrating Hand Wash. Made with natural ingredients such as coco-glucoside and natural glycerin, this Hand Wash will make your hands feel soft, clean and comfortable. The hand wash has a sparkling fragrance, consisting of green tea, sage and citrus notes. The refillable glass bottle is manufactured in Europe and is 30% lighter in weight. This saves material and reduces CO2 emissions. Save on this product and the environment by using our easy refill packaging.

Ingredients

aqua, coco-glucoside, sodium coco-sulfate, glycerin, parfum, cocamidopropyl betaine, glyceryl oleate, lactic acid, tocopherol, hydrogenated palm glycerides citrate, sodium chloride, linalool, sodium benzoate, potassium sorbate, citric acid

About the brand

Marie-Stella-Maris' passion for design and attention to detail is reflected in everything, from design to fragrance, from ingredient to packaging. Marie-Stella-Maris is a Dutch social enterprise with a mission: 'Access to clean water and hygiene for everyone, worldwide!' The sales of mineral water, body care, and luxury home fragrances contribute to this mission. The body care products are made from natural ingredients, with distinctive unisex scents and an eye for detail. To reduce environmental impact, Marie-Stella-Maris develops sustainable refill packaging. Refilling means less packaging material, less waste, and lower CO2 emissions.
